The SCAMPER technique is one of the brainstorming tools that allows us to explore solutions to problems by altering the current product through seven different approaches: Substitute, Combine, Adapt, Modify, Put in Another Use, Eliminate, and Rearrange. In this article, we will examine examples of the SCAMPER technique and how it is applied in the real world by different companies.
